## Reseller Programme — Board Brief (Managers Only)

The Ardenfall reseller programme goes live next quarter. Two tiers: certified and premier. Margins set at 22% and 30% respectively. Twelve partners signed in the Meridia region; eight more in diligence. Onboarding handled by Soline's channel team. Support costs are within forecast. No exclusivity granted anywhere. The strategic intent behind the tier structure is noted below.

management briefing: The renewal with Zoraelax Group closes at $10 million a year, 15 percent below the last contract. Project Ralael slips by six weeks because of the audit delay.

### Changelog — Fennelworks handlers, cold start defaults

Heads up for the sync: we bumped the default warm-pool size and shortened the idle timeout on the Quillstack serverless runtime. Cold starts on the checkout handlers dropped from ~1.8s to ~400ms in staging, at a modest cost bump. Nothing else changed in routing. The new defaults now shipping to all environments are listed below.

settings of kajef-hafog:
[ralys]
team = holiel
access_code = ac_fa834c
owner = noviel.gilion
host = ralys.halixlabs.test
port = 9300
peer = raldor.ordindata.local
salt = e78ca807
pin = 4961

### Sensor drift — Vernleaf controller

The Vernleaf greenhouse controller recalibrates humidity sensors nightly; drift beyond 4% triggers a maintenance flag, not an outage. Tell growers it's expected after firmware updates. If you redeploy the calibration bundle manually, the tooling requires a signed package, and the key you should use is the following.

deploy key for kajof-fajop: bky6_gDHw9Q

The resolver caches records for 60 seconds, but under churn, stale entries point at decommissioned nodes, producing sporadic timeouts rather than hard failures. New team members should retry with exponential backoff and confirm the resolved address matches the published service range before escalating. When testing resolution behaviour through the diagnostics endpoint, authenticate each request with the bearer token below.

session JWT of yawep-yawep = eyJhbGciOiJIUzI1NiIsInR5cCI6IkpXVCJ9.eyJzdWIiOiI3pWF3_In0.aXYsHiog